Output 807bdf793787ca5e504248dd5303c7ecaf423a2b486b00997b0f01f7d648cc8f:7

value
20345633
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d20e514cafa810b78318a4125b6ddb6137109bf OP_EQUAL
address
MR9BMG3qiinA2yufLZaURdjnL7H6TrmbXq
transaction
807bdf793787ca5e504248dd5303c7ecaf423a2b486b00997b0f01f7d648cc8f
spent
true